New Moon Teachings and Meditation

Picture
Indigenous cultures, worldwide, knew how to live in balance and harmony with the Earth's cycles and rhythms. The movements of the Sun, Moon and Planets played an integral part in daily life. There is a profound connection between women and the Moon - a connection that can affect your personal inner peace and balance. 

Our teacher Mary Ann McClellan is the co-founder, with her late husband, Medicine Hawk, of Earth Mother Awareness on the Northshore and represents Louisiana on a Grandmothers Council in Arizona. She currently works with the founder and director of the International Indigenous Grandmothers Society.

New Moon News  

NEWS GOING FORWARD:

Teacher Mary Ann McClellan of Earth Mother Awareness has decided to focus her energies on the deep teachings and ceremonies of Purification Lodge and Vision Quest. So we will forego the New Moon gatherings until further notice. You are encouraged to spend some quiet time alone or with other women on the new moon, which is Wednesday, November 11 this month. 

For more information on ceremonies with Mary Ann, wife of the late Medicine Hawk, please contact her at [email protected] or (985) 796-5377. She is located in Folsom. Learn more at www.earthmotherawareness.com.

Mary Ann may occasionally join us at the Grandmother Group, which is another good way to learn introductory Native teachings at the time of the new moon, for those women over 50. Deep gratitude to Mary Ann for all she has taught many founders of the Women's Center over the last 20-plus years, and for her recent volunteer offerings at the Center. Watch for our special introductory speaking events with Mary Ann in the future.
